We have been building a lot this week, to help students develop and improve their spatial awareness.

While we are building we also count the number of blocks that we are using to make our towers.







In the afternoon we focus on our fine motor skills. This week we have introduced putting beads on a string. This is great for developing their fine motor skills as well as developing skills such as concentration.

While the students are putting the beads on the string we have them identify the different colors they are using.
